Season and care of Pecan and Nutmeg is important to know. While considering everything about Pecan and Nutmeg Care, growing season is an essential factor. Pecan season is Spring, Summer and Fall and Nutmeg season is Spring, Summer and Fall. The type of soil for Pecan is Loam and for Nutmeg is Clay, Loam, Sand while the PH of soil for Pecan is Acidic, Neutral and for Nutmeg is Acidic, Neutral.

Care of Pecan and Nutmeg include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Pecan pruning is done Cut upper 1/3 section when young to enhancegrowth and Remove dead branches and Nutmeg pruning is done In Early Autumn, Prune to stimulate growth and Remove dead leaves. In summer Pecan need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water. Whereas, in summer Nutmeg need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water.
